A majority of these cases involved victims who were exposed to asbestos in a variety of work sites, including oil and gas facilities and shipyards, power plants, and factories. People who have been exposed to asbestos run the risk of developing serious diseases such as asbestosis or mesothelioma.

A Beaumont mesothelioma attorney will help you gather all the information needed to bring a lawsuit. The victim or family members must adhere to a certain date, known as the statute of limitations or else they lose the right to sue. For mesothelioma cases, the statute of limitation is two years following the date of diagnosis. In the case of a claim for wrongful death the statute of limitations is two years from the date that the victim died.

Mesothelioma is primarily due to asbestos, a fire retardant and insulating material that was utilized in a variety of construction materials. The fibers of asbestos can be ingested or swallowed by workers and cause mesothelioma as well as lung cancer. Symptoms usually appear between 20 to 50 years after exposure.

Beaumont mesothelioma attorneys can help Mesothelioma patients meet the deadlines to file a lawsuit. The statutes of limitations vary between states. People who delay filing a file may lose their right to compensation. In Beaumont, victims and their families have two years from the diagnosis of mesothelioma to file a lawsuit. They also have two years to file a wrongful death lawsuit following the mesothelioma death. In addition, some victims can be part of a multidistrict litigation (MDL) or multistate litigation (NSL). NSLs and multistate litigations can accelerate the process of obtaining compensation.
